The Yuva Nidhi Scheme Karnataka 2026 is one of the major unemployment assistance programmes launched by the Government of Karnataka. Under this initiative, eligible youth who have completed their education but have not secured employment receive monthly financial support. The scheme aims to reduce financial stress during the job-search phase and promote skill development among graduates and diploma holders.
The official guidelines for 2026 include updates in the application process, verification, and disbursement, all of which are explained in detail below.
What is Yuva Nidhi Scheme Karnataka 2026?
The Yuva Nidhi Scheme is a direct benefit transfer (DBT) programme providing monthly allowance to unemployed youth after completing their degree, diploma, or ITI. The scheme benefits thousands of students who are searching for job opportunities and require temporary financial support.
To make the process simple, the government offers an online application facility through the Yuva Nidhi Seva Sindhu portal.

Eligibility Criteria for Yuva Nidhi Scheme
To apply for the scheme, candidates must fulfil the following conditions:
- Must be a permanent resident of Karnataka
- Applicant must have completed degree, diploma, or ITI
- Must be unemployed for at least 3 months after completing studies
- Should not be working in any private or government job
- Should not be receiving any other unemployment allowance
Only eligible candidates should submit the yuva nidhi application to receive financial aid.
Required Documents
Candidates must keep the following documents ready before applying:
- Aadhaar Card
- Mobile Number
- SSLC Number
- Bank Passbook
- Income Certificate
- Domicile Certificate
- Yuva Nidhi Self Declaration form
- Educational Certificate (Degree/Diploma/ITI)
Uploading clear documents helps in faster approval.
How to Apply Online for Yuva Nidhi Scheme 2026?
The application process is completely digital through the dedicated portal. Follow these steps:
- Visit the official portal of Yuva Nidhi Seva Sindhu
- Select the relevant option for yuva nidhi application
- Complete the Aadhaar-based eKYC
- Upload the required documents
- Fill the self-declaration form
- Review the details and submit
Once submitted, applicants can track their application through the yuva nidhi status check option.
Yuva Nidhi Self Declaration – Why It Is Important?
The yuva nidhi self declaration is a mandatory form where applicants confirm that they are unemployed. The government requires a declaration to ensure that only eligible individuals receive benefits.
For transparency and easy verification, the government has also provided a yuvanidhi self declaration link, where applicants can directly upload or update their form.
The declaration must be renewed every 3 months, as mentioned under the yuvanidhi self declaration 3 months rule.
How to Check Yuva Nidhi Status Online?
After submitting the application, candidates should regularly track the approval process. To check status:
- Open the yuva nidhi check status page – https://sevasindhuservices.karnataka.gov.in/
- Enter Aadhaar or mobile number
- Complete OTP verification
- View application status on the screen
The yuva nidhi status must be checked often to avoid delays in payments.
Yuva Nidhi Application Last Date 2026
The government has not officially announced any fixed deadline. However, applicants should submit their yuva nidhi application as soon as they complete the mandatory waiting period of 3 months after their final exam results.
Delaying the process may lead to late verification or late disbursement of benefits.
